Initial one-time setup is roughly $1.8M driven by secure facility retrofit/construction, thaumaturgic monitoring installation, transport and security hardware, and contingency reserves. Recurring annual costs are approximately $2.55M driven primarily by staff wages (security, thaumaturges, researchers, handlers) and an ongoing long-term research program reserve.

Personnel
21 total
| Role | Count |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Security Officer / MTF Agent | 7 | [#5] 2–4 permanent guards plus an on-call 4-person rapid-response/capture team; counted together as 7 security staff |
| Monitoring Specialist / Thaumaturge | 3 | [#1, #2] 2–3 full-time thaumaturgic monitoring specialists (modeled as 3 full-time equivalents for 24/7 coverage) |
| Research Scientist | 2 | [#11] Cognitive scientists/linguists/biologists (1–3 range; modeled as 2 senior researchers) |
| Lab Technician / Research Assistant | 1 | [#11, #13] Laboratory technical support for biological sampling and experiments |
| Animal Handler / Equine Specialist | 3 | [#6] 2–4 specialized handlers/behaviorists (modeled as 3) |
| Veterinarian / Medical Officer | 1 | [#7] On-call or part-time veterinary specialist for equine medicine and emergency surgery |
| Covert Operative / Intelligence Agent | 2 | [#15] Agents supporting surveillance of related occult groups (operational staff for infiltration/surveillance) |
| Site Director / Administrative Staff | 1 | [#14, #24] Oversees site operations, legal/cover coordination, and archival/compliance |
| Engineer / Maintenance | 1 | [#4, #17] Facility maintenance and engineer to support HVAC, security systems, and routine repairs |
